A common assumption is that car rentals are a fixed monthly line item. In reality, they respond to market fluctuations and user behavior—offering room for optimization. Another myth is that lower rates mean reduced safety or vehicle quality; in fact, improved fleet management and data-driven inventory pricing maintain reliability. Transparency in pricing and clear communication from providers play key roles in building trust.
Your monthly car rental budget depends on multiple factors: rental length, vehicle class, insurance options, fuel policies, and provider promotions. Unlike fixed monthly costs for utilities or housing, car rental expenses are scalable and often flexible. Many providers now offer tiered pricing models, allowing users to select vehicles that balance comfort and affordability. Fuel combustion costs, regulated rental policies, and rental duration all influence how much you pay per month. Understanding these variables helps travelers make informed choices, especially when new promotions align with seasonal shifts or fleet upgrades.

In recent months, rising competition among car rental platforms, declining seasonal demand in key urban corridors, and efforts to retain price-sensitive customers have reshaped rental pricing. These shifts reflect broader economic signals, including reduced fuel volatility and a rebound in leisure travel after periods of cautious spending. For cost-conscious users, this means tools and offers are more accessible—helping people plan transport without stretching their monthly budget thin. What was once seen as a fixed expense is now part of a more dynamic financial landscape.
